Boom Merchant delivers a new powerful 3-track EP, ‘Free Dinner’.

Boom Merchant is an exciting techno talent who is back on T78’s record label Autektone Dark with a powerful dark and driving techno EP entitled ‘Free Dinner‘.

Free Dinner” features three piledriving techno productions, each of which combine gritty percussion with ominous tension to form hypnotic grooves. It’s a trademark style that Boom Merchant has also showcased on his own label Tribal Pulse plus Dolma Red.

Boom Merchant is known for his intense style of techno which blends ominous atmospherics with menacing synth lines and thundering percussion. His dance floor focused style utilises an innate ability of knowing how to captivate an audience, and his music has been released by record labels ranging from Dolma Red to his own Tribal Pulse.

Originally from Ireland, Boom Merchant has made Glasgow in Scotland his adopted home. Techno fans from the Scottish city are more than familiar with Boom Merchant, as he is a resident DJ at the city’s popular early hours nightclub Surge Glasgow.

Tracks description.

Picnic” opens the EP with a short atmospheric intro, before the thumping kick drum starts to lead the groove. Atmospheric vocals and sweeping synths are propelled by the fast-paced rhythms of intense percussion.

Next up, “Free Dinner” has a gritty bassline and industrial bursts that are accompanied by rattling hi-hats, while the boom of the kick drives the track. The diva-ish vocal sample that defines the track also adds a quirky vibe to the intensity of the groove.

Track three, “Drop” is a monstrous cut built around a lurching bassline, which creates tension and intensity that’s ready to pounce at any moment. It’s an unrelenting cut that unfolds with thundering percussion and looming suspense.
